The presented RT-PCR data displays the relative expression levels of BRC1-1 and BRC1-2 transcripts in the apices of wild-type plants grown under short photoperiod (SP) conditions for varying durations, as indicated. The obtained values have been normalized to the reference gene UBQ and represent the average of three independent biological replicates. The error bars correspond to standard error of mean (SEM). The letters (a-e) above each bar signify significant differences (p < 0.001) observed at different time points during SP treatment. A one-way ANOVA was employed for statistical analysis.
